"The Rough Guide to Cult Movies" offers a blend of essential trivia and informed opinion as it takes you on a tour of the most compellingly weird - and weirdly compelling - films in the world. Whether you're a paid-up member of The Big Lebowski fan club or just looking for a night in with an interesting DVD, "The Rough Guide to Cult Movies" is the ultimate guide to the world's most memorable films. "The Rough Guide to Cult Movies" selects cinema's most compelling triumphs: films that are brilliant, intriguing or just plain bizarre; from action flicks to zombie films, by way of nuns, yakuza, musicals and mutations. You'll find expert, pithy reviews of over 1500 movies, with forgotten legends like Charlie Chan and the Opera or contemporary classics like "There Will Be Blood", plus filmmakers' picks of their favourite cult movies, in their own words.
